Don’t wait for overflow to happen. 77% of operators report staffing shortages during peak periods, making reactive fixes ineffective. Use Answrr’s onboarding assistant to pre-configure overflow rules for known high-demand times—tax season, Black Friday, or viral marketing campaigns.
- Define trigger conditions: call volume thresholds, after-hours windows, or system overload alerts
- Customize greetings with brand voice and tone (e.g., Rime Arcana voices for natural-sounding interaction)
- Pre-load FAQs and service-specific scripts to ensure consistency
This setup ensures your AI is ready before the first call hits—eliminating downtime and missed opportunities.

Deploying the system is only half the battle. Abandoned call rates can drop by up to 37% with proper tracking—but only if you measure what matters.
Track these KPIs monthly:
- Abandonment rate (goal: <10%)
- Average time to first response (goal: <10 minutes)
- Conversion rate from missed call recovery (Answrr internal data: 60–75% recoverable)
- Sentiment trends (via post-call summaries)
Use insights to refine scripts, adjust triggers, and train human agents on high-value handoffs.
For complex or emotional inquiries, route calls to human agents—Answrr handles the overflow, humans handle the empathy. This hybrid model improves first-call resolution by up to 25% while cutting costs by 18–22%.
- Set escalation rules based on keywords, sentiment, or call duration
- Use AI to summarize context before handoff
- Maintain a seamless experience across channels
